Eddie House spent the last two and a half seasons with the Boston Celtics,
winning an NBA championship while becoming one of the league's best pure
shooters and sixth men in the process.
So what?
According to House, that is old news. He is now a New York Knick through and
through, and any nostalgic feelings were pushed aside when his current team
played his old one Tuesday night in Boston.
"I had some great times in Boston, and no one can take that away from me, but
that is in the past," he said. "I am only focused on being a Knick right now,
and I am happy to be here. I am focused on helping turn this team around and
getting as many wins as we can with the games we have left."
In 209 games with the Celtics, House averaged 7.8 points, 1.8 rebounds and
1.3 assists in 18.2 minutes per game. His best season, however, came as a key
reserve for Mike D'Antoni's Phoenix Suns in 2005-06, when he averaged a
career-high 9.8 ppg in helping lead the team to the Western Conference Finals.
"(I've always said) D'Antoni's one of the best guys I've played for," House
said. "He lets you play with freedom. I've talked that up and then I ended up
here so it's kind of funny. It's nice. It could be kind of difficult coming
into a system you don't know, you have to try to pick up the plays and you
are out on the court thinking. But I know the system here. I'm just playing.
He lets you play and that feels good."
It also feels good for House to have The Garden crowd on his side for once,
not rooting against him.
"Knicks fans, they get behind you if you play hard and put a good product on
the floor," he said. "It felt good to hear them out there. Anytime you get
the support of the fans it always feels good. I am one of those guys who
feeds off the energy of the crowd, and I want them to feed off my energy as
well. It's a great thing being here."
Over his 10-year NBA career, House has played for the Miami Heat, L.A.
Clippers, Charlotte Bobcats, Milwaukee Bucks, Sacramento Kings and New Jersey
Nets in addition to his tenure with the Celtics and Suns. Now with his ninth
team, he clearly is no stranger to the league and the storied past each
franchise boasts. That is part of the reason why he is proud to now don the
orange and blue.
"Coming (to the Knicks), at first it feels kind of awkward because I've been
playing for the other team for so many years," House said with a slight smile
across his face. "But coming here, it's a great atmosphere, great fans and a
great history. It is a lot of fun to go out there and play on this stage. No
matter what happens, this is a team that competes hard. I haven't always been
able to say that on some of the other teams I've been a part of, but this
team and these guys, they play hard. That's important. Good things happen
from that."
